基于matlab的恒功率控制
时间: 2023-08-23 07:02:30 浏览: 50
基于Matlab的恒功率控制是一种用于维持系统功率恒定的控制方法。在电力系统中,功率控制是非常重要的,可以保证系统的稳定运行和负载分配。
在该方法中,首先需要获取系统中各个节点的功率信息,包括发电机的输出功率和负载的功率需求。利用Matlab软件的数据处理和计算功能,可以方便地对这些数据进行处理和分析。通过对功率信息的处理,可以得到系统的总功率和各个节点的功率差值。
然后,通过对功率差值进行控制,可以调整发电机的输出功率,使其与系统负载的功率需求保持平衡,即保持恒功率。通过Matlab中的控制算法,可以根据功率差值的大小和方向,自动调节发电机的功率输出。这样可以实现系统的稳定运行,并避免功率过载或过低的问题。
此外,基于Matlab的恒功率控制还可以通过对系统的其他参数进行监测和调整,如电压、频率等。通过对这些参数的监测和分析,可以更好地了解整个系统的运行状态,并及时采取相应的控制策略。
综上所述,基于Matlab的恒功率控制是一种有效的控制方法,可以帮助维持电力系统的功率平衡,实现系统的稳定运行。通过Matlab软件的数据处理和控制算法,可以实现对功率差值的自动调节,以保持系统的功率恒定。
相关问题
matlab恒功率负载
matlab恒功率负载是指在matlab中通过调整电压和电流来保持恒定功率输出的负载。在传统的电阻负载中,功率是由电压和电流的乘积决定的。但在matlab中,我们可以使用控制算法来调整电流和电压,以保持恒定的功率输出。
matlab中的恒功率负载可以使用数学模型和控制系统来实现。首先,我们需要将预期的功率设定为一个固定的值。然后,我们可以通过测量并调整电压和电流来维持所设定的功率水平。
为了实现这一目标,我们可以使用PID控制算法。PID控制器根据输入的误差信号(期望功率与实际功率之差)来调整输出(电压和电流)以达到所需的功率。PID控制器通过比例、积分和微分三个参数来调整负载的电压和电流。
具体来说,在matlab中可以使用控制系统工具箱来设计这样的PID控制器。我们需要指定所需的功率设定,并且通过实时测量实际功率值来提供反馈给控制器。PID控制器将根据这些反馈信号来计算并调整输出,以实现恒定功率输出。
总之,matlab恒功率负载是通过调整电压和电流来保持恒定功率输出的负载。使用PID控制算法,我们可以在matlab中设计和实现恒功率负载系统,以满足特定的功率输出要求。
基于matlab的矢量控制系统
基于matlab的矢量控制系统是一种利用matlab软件进行矢量控制设计和分析的系统。矢量控制是一种电机控制技术,它可以通过控制电机的电流和电压来实现精确的速度和位置调节。在matlab中,可以利用矢量控制工具箱进行系统建模、控制器设计和性能分析。
首先,利用matlab可以进行电机和传感器的建模,包括机械特性、电气特性和传感器特性等。然后可以利用矢量控制工具箱中的控制器设计工具进行控制器设计,可以选择不同的控制算法和参数来实现不同的控制性能。最后,利用matlab可以进行系统的仿真和实时性能分析,可以评估系统的稳定性、动态响应和抗干扰能力等性能指标。
基于matlab的矢量控制系统具有良好的灵活性和扩展性,可以适用于不同类型的电机和控制需求。它还可以与其他matlab工具箱进行无缝整合,如信号处理工具箱、优化工具箱等,从而可以实现更加复杂的控制系统设计和分析。总之,基于matlab的矢量控制系统为工程师和研究人员提供了一个强大的工具,可以帮助他们快速高效地设计和分析矢量控制系统。